All errors (new ones prefixed by >>):

>> drivers/hwmon/pmbus/tda38640.c:118:7: error: use of undeclared identifier 'CONFIG_SENSORS_TDA38640_REGULATOR'
           if (!CONFIG_SENSORS_TDA38640_REGULATOR || !np ||
                ^
   1 error generated.


vim +/CONFIG_SENSORS_TDA38640_REGULATOR +118 drivers/hwmon/pmbus/tda38640.c

   106	
   107	static int tda38640_probe(struct i2c_client *client)
   108	{
   109		struct device *dev = &client->dev;
   110		struct device_node *np = dev_of_node(dev);
   111		struct tda38640_data *data;
   112	
   113		data = devm_kzalloc(dev, sizeof(*data), GFP_KERNEL);
   114		if (!data)
   115			return -ENOMEM;
   116		memcpy(&data->info, &tda38640_info, sizeof(tda38640_info));
   117	
 > 118		if (!CONFIG_SENSORS_TDA38640_REGULATOR || !np ||
   119		    of_property_read_u32(np, "infineon,en-pin-fixed-level", &data->en_pin_lvl))
   120			return pmbus_do_probe(client, &data->info);
   121	
   122		/*
   123		 * Apply ON_OFF_CONFIG workaround as enabling the regulator using the
   124		 * OPERATION register doesn't work in SVID mode.
   125		 */
   126		data->info.read_byte_data = tda38640_read_byte_data;
   127		data->info.write_byte_data = tda38640_write_byte_data;
   128		/*
   129		 * One should configure PMBUS_ON_OFF_CONFIG here, but
   130		 * PB_ON_OFF_CONFIG_POWERUP_CONTROL, PB_ON_OFF_CONFIG_EN_PIN_REQ and
   131		 * PB_ON_OFF_CONFIG_EN_PIN_REQ are ignored by the device.
   132		 * Only PB_ON_OFF_CONFIG_POLARITY_HIGH has an effect.
   133		 */
   134	
   135		return pmbus_do_probe(client, &data->info);
   136	}
   137
